☉ Sun in ♎ Libra
The solar ego finds equilibrium through the mirror of human relationships.
In the sign of Libra, the Sun is in its sign of 'fall,' signaling a fundamental shift from the assertive, individualistic drive of Aries to a focus on social cohesion and objective awareness. Here, the solar force is filtered through the lens of partnership, diplomacy, and the aesthetic pursuit of harmony. The individual thrives not through solitary conquest, but by understanding their identity reflected in the faces of others. There is a profound need for validation, which can sometimes lead to indecision or a tendency to compromise personal integrity for the sake of keeping the peace.
Because the Sun represents the core vital force, those with this placement are motivated by fairness, justice, and the desire to balance opposing viewpoints. They possess a natural talent for mediation and a keen eye for beauty and social grace. However, the shadow of this position is the potential for codependency; the Sun may struggle to shine independently when it feels tethered to the perceptions or needs of a significant other. Success for this placement involves learning that true balance is not the erasure of self, but the integration of self within the social contract.
